Reloadable cards are now even being used by large companies such as the Ford Motor Company and U-Haul International to provide employees with quick access to their money.

Payroll debit cards now allow large companies such as Ford to give workers their paychecks and bonuses without the expense and hassle of a paper check. Employers put over $2.1 billion on benefit debit cards in 2004. This is up 12 percent from the previous year, according to research firm Mercator Advisory Group.

Ford employs over 135,000 people in the US. This alone can be very costly for payroll using paper check processing.
